发布时间:2024-11-22 04:48:37
作为一名专业的 Golang 开发者,学习 Golang 的时间是一个非常关键的因素。对于不同的人来说,所需的学习时间可能会有所不同。有些人可能会很快上手,而有些人可能需要更长的时间来掌握这门语言。在下面的文章中,我将探讨学习 Golang 所需的时间并分享个人的经验和建议。
Golang(或称为 Go)是谷歌开发的一门编程语言,它结合了静态类型语言的性能和动态类型语言的易用性。Golang 是一门具有高并发、易于部署的语言,并且拥有简洁而富有表达力的语法。它被设计用于构建高效的网络服务和分布式系统。
对于有其他编程语言背景的开发者来说,入门 Golang 可能会相对容易一些。因为 Golang 的语法相对简单,并且具有一些常见编程语言所共有的概念和特性,如变量、循环和条件语句等。如果你已经具备其他编程语言的知识,那么你可能只需要几天的时间就能熟悉 Golang 的基本语法和特性。
要真正地掌握 Golang,你需要在实践中不断地使用它。一旦你熟悉了基本的语法和特性,你可以开始编写一些简单的小项目来巩固你的知识。通过编写实际的代码,你将更好地理解 Golang 的设计理念和最佳实践。这个过程可能需要几个月的时间,具体取决于你的学习能力和经验。
除了不断地练习和编写代码外,还有一些其他的方法可以帮助你更快地提高你的 Golang 技能。
首先,阅读 Golang 的官方文档是一个不错的选择。官方文档详细介绍了 Golang 的各种特性和用法,并提供了一些示例代码。阅读官方文档可以让你更深入地了解 Golang,并学习到一些高级的技巧和技术。
其次,参与开源项目也是一个提高 Golang 技能的好方法。通过参与开源项目,你可以与其他有经验的 Golang 开发者合作,学习他们的思维方式和工作流程。你还可以通过贡献代码来获得反馈,这对于提高自己的编码能力是非常有益的。
最后,持续学习和关注 Golang 社区也非常重要。Golang 社区非常活跃,有很多优秀的博客、论坛和社交媒体账号可以提供有价值的学习资源。定期阅读和学习社区中的最新动态和技术进展,可以让你保持与行业同步并不断提升自己的技能。
总结而言,学习 Golang 所需的时间因人而异。但无论你花费多长时间,通过不断地实践和学习,你一定能够成为一名优秀的 Golang 开发者。